Fig. 6
Hey2 negatively regulates the expression of CPC-associated genes. (A-F) WISH staining for SHF markers nkx2.5, mef2cb and ltbp3 at 24 hpf in hey2 heterozygous (A-C) and hey2 mutant (D-F) embryos. (G-I) Quantitative RT-PCR at 24 hpf of mef2cb, ltbp3 and nkx2.5 gene expression. (J,K) Confocal image of Mef2 immunostaining in Tg(myl7:EGFP) hey2 heterozygous (J) and mutant (K) embryos. Arrowheads indicate Mef2+ cells in the arterial pole of the heart. (L,M) Total number of Mef2+ cells in the arterial pole of the heart (L) and in the heart proper (M, with chambers counted separately) in control and hey2 mutant embryos at 48 hpf (N=3, n=4). (N-S) RNA in situ hybridization analysis of expression of nkx2.5, mef2cb and hey2 at 16.5 hpf in hey2 heterozygous (N-P) and mutant (Q-S) embryos. (T-V) Quantitative RT-PCR analysis showing relative expression levels of mef2cb, nkx2.5 and hey2 at 16.5 hpf in hey2 heterozygous and mutant embryos (gene expression normalized to β-actin, fold difference relative to control; N=3, n=3).
